Birmingham, Alabama, located in Jefferson, has a population of 212,069. The population has declined 13% since 2000. The average temperature in January is 42° and 80° in July. The area includes 87,280 households, with an average household size of 2 people. Birmingham households are made up of an estimated 98,993 men and 113,076 women. In Birmingham, 28% of those living in the area are married and of the 87,280 households, 55% are families with two or more people living in the home. About 29% of households have one or more children living at home. The median age of Birmingham residents is 36 years. The city is home to many loyal Birmingham Barons (Aa) sports fans.
